5 Busted For Crystal Meth In Lacey Apartment: Police

One is in jail, but four were released, police said.

LACEY, N.J. — Five people were charged with having crystal methamphetamine Friday in a Lacey apartment, police said. Officials executed a search warrant following a seven-month investigation into drug distribution and possession, according to the Lacey Police Department.

Officials found large quantities of crystal meth and several prescription medications, including Oxycodone and Clonazepam. There were also hypodermic syringes, glass smoking pipes and straws containing residue and "drug paraphernalia consistent with the packaging and distribution of narcotics, including digital scales, cutting agents, baggies, and ledgers," according to police.

All were charged with meth possession, police said. Caruso was charged with distrubution and intent to distribute, officials said. Trangone and Deusinger were charged with intent to distribute, according to police.

Charlie was taken to Ocean County Correctional Facility, according to officials. The other four were released on complaint summonses pending future court appearances, police said. It was not immediately clear why Charlie was lodged while the others were released.
